To specify custom optimization settings:
In the Optimize panel, choose an option from the Export File Format pop-up menu.
1
Set format-specific options, such as color depth, dither, and quality.
2
Choose other optimization settings from the Optimize panel Options menu, as necessary.
3

To optimize individual slices:
Click a slice to select it. Shift-click to select more than one slice.
1
Optimize the selected slices using the Optimize panel.
2
